spoon Posted February 15, 2014 Share Posted February 15, 2014 I'm from Sydney, Australia and so I never would have guessed that I'd meet Sufjan Stevens (one of my favourite artists) at a video shoot for his project with Son Lux and Serengeti (Sisyphus) in LA. I was cast in the video and had the chance to speak with Sufjan in the artist room for about 10 minutes, definitely one of the kindest/nicest/friendliest musicians I've ever met. I'm only in LA for a few weeks and had no idea this opportunity would present itself so I didn't have any of my Sufjan records on hand but I brought along my girlfriend's copy of Illinois and had it signed for her: openupyourskull 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
